About the role

We're looking for a Tech Lead Manager to lead a team of engineers building production generative AI systems. You'll combine hands-on technical leadership with people management, setting the technical direction for the team while growing the engineers on it.

What you'll do
  • Lead and grow a team of engineers, balancing hands-on technical leadership with people support.
  • Own the technical roadmap and quality bar for your team's systems.
  • Own the business outcome. Partner with product management and work across teams to translate customer and business needs into technical deliverables.
  • Personally contribute direct technical output: write design docs, drive key architectural decisions, and write production code yourself for the highest-leverage or highest-risk problems.
  • Stay close to the architecture and technical details of what your team builds well enough to review design decisions, unblock engineers, and make prioritization calls.
  • Set and uphold engineering standards: code quality, testing, eval-driven development, and production monitoring for both reliability and output quality.
  • Manage prioritization and tradeoffs across competing priorities, and coordinate closely with adjacent teams whose work depends on yours.
  • Hire, mentor, and develop engineers; run performance and career development for direct reports.


What we're looking for
  • Proven experience leading engineering teams as a manager, with a track record of shipping production systems.
  • Strong technical background in generative AI / LLM-based systems, with enough expertise to provide the technical depth and direction where the team needs.
  • Able to work directly as a technical contributor, creating design and implementing solutions.
  • Experience operating production ML/LLM systems: eval-driven development, monitoring for both reliability and output quality, and staged rollouts.
  • Past experience in one or more of the following areas: NLP, content/document understanding, search/retrieval, Agent framework or LLM training infra/frameworks.
  • Track record of hiring, mentoring, and growing engineers, and of navigating performance and leveling conversations directly.
  • Strong cross-functional partnership skills - comfortable setting a technical roadmap in a room with product, other engineering leads, and company leadership.
  • Comfortable operating in a dynamic, fast-paced, outcome-driven environment with real ambiguity in scope.


Great to have
  • Experience scaling a team through a significant architectural transition.
  • Familiarity with canary rollouts for ML/LLM systems.

About Ironclad

Ironclad is a legal technology company that provides a contract management platform. The platform helps legal teams manage contracts more efficiently and effectively. Ironclad's products include contract workflow, contract analytics, and contract collaboration. The company was founded in 2014 and is headquartered in San Francisco, California.
